What can I do to protect myself when using the centre?
Answer
- Wash your hands often with soap and running water for at least 20 seconds. Dry with paper towel or a hand dryer.
- Wipe down any equipment you use throughout the centre with the wipes provided.
- Try not to touch your eyes, nose or mouth.
- Cover your nose and mouth with a tissue when you cough or sneeze. If you don’t have a tissue, cough or sneeze into your upper sleeve or elbow.
- Wear a mask when you cannot socially distance and maintain at least 1.5 metres distance between yourself and others at all times
